Position Overview

As a Facilities Technician specializing in life science environments, you will serve as a key technical resource within our Facility Management team. This role combines hands‑on technical expertise with coordination responsibilities to ensure optimal facility operations for our life science clients. You will manage maintenance activities, coordinate external vendors, and support critical facility functions while maintaining compliance with industry‑specific standards.

Key Responsibilities

Technical Operations

  • Execute preventive and corrective maintenance on building systems, equipment, and infrastructure (excluding HVAC systems)
  • Perform general repair and maintenance work using manual skills and technical expertise
  • Support renovation projects, refurbishments, and minor infrastructure initiatives
  • Operate forklifts for material handling and goods receipt operations during client absences

Coordination & Vendor Management

  • Coordinate external service providers and trade contractors for maintenance and repair activities
  • Process and manage work order tickets through first‑level technical support
  • Monitor maintenance activities and maintain accurate documentation of completed work
  • Ensure compliance with safety, quality, and environmental standards per JLL protocols
